Key Points Revealed: Big Changes to Bus And Rail Pass Systems Soon in Hungary
All types of passes on state railway company MÁV and state coach service Volán will be abolished from March 1, as only countrywide and county passes will be available, Construction and Transport Minister János Lázár announced at a press conference held with mayor László Papp in Debrecen.

New passes will be introduced valid for 24 hours on all MÁV and Volán routes in single counties or across Hungary.

The system of discounts will also be reformed, as 43 of the current 65 concessions will be abolished, including the discount for civil servants.

People working in education and healthcare, as well as public employees, will be provided with unlimited travel with a 50% discount, replacing the stamp-collecting system.

Travel will be free for those over 65 and children under 14. Travel for those who now are entitled to a 90% discount, such as large families and the disabled, will be free.

Bank card payments will be allowed on all Volánbusz lines from the autumn. A Ft 200 administration fee will then be charged for cash payments. This would favour payment by bank card and reduce the number of abuses.
